// Emulation of posix scandir() call
#include <config.h>
#include <string.h>
#include <windows.h>
#include <stdlib.h>
struct dirent { char d_name[1]; };
int scandir(const char *dirname, struct dirent ***namelist,
int (*select)(struct dirent *),
int (*compar)(struct dirent **, struct dirent **)) {
int len;
char *findIn, *d;
WIN32_FIND_DATA find;
HANDLE h;
int nDir = 0, NDir = 0;
struct dirent **dir = 0, *selectDir;
unsigned long ret;
len = strlen(dirname);
findIn = malloc(len+5);
strcpy(findIn, dirname);
for (d = findIn; *d; d++) if (*d=='/') *d='\\';
if ((len==0)) { strcpy(findIn, ".\\*"); }
if ((len==1)&& (d[-1]=='.')) { strcpy(findIn, ".\\*"); }
if ((len>0) && (d[-1]=='\\')) { *d++ = '*'; *d = 0; }
if ((len>1) && (d[-1]=='.') && (d[-2]=='\\')) { d[-1] = '*'; }
if ((h=FindFirstFile(findIn, &find))==INVALID_HANDLE_VALUE) {
ret = GetLastError();
if (ret != ERROR_NO_MORE_FILES) {
// TODO: return some error code
}
*namelist = dir;
return nDir;
}
do {
selectDir=(struct dirent*)malloc(sizeof(struct dirent)+strlen(find.cFileName));
strcpy(selectDir->d_name, find.cFileName);
if (!select || (*select)(selectDir)) {
if (nDir==NDir) {
struct dirent **tempDir = calloc(sizeof(struct dirent*), NDir+33);
if (NDir) memcpy(tempDir, dir, sizeof(struct dirent*)*NDir);
if (dir) free(dir);
dir = tempDir;
NDir += 32;
}
dir[nDir] = selectDir;
nDir++;
dir[nDir] = 0;
} else {
free(selectDir);
}
} while (FindNextFile(h, &find));
ret = GetLastError();
if (ret != ERROR_NO_MORE_FILES) {
// TODO: return some error code
}
FindClose(h);
free (findIn);
if (compar) qsort (dir, nDir, sizeof(*dir),
(int(*)(const void*, const void*))compar);
*namelist = dir;
return nDir;
}
int alphasort (struct dirent **a, struct dirent **b) {
return strcmp ((*a)->d_name, (*b)->d_name);
}
